What is a remote inventory analyst?

A Remote Inventory Analyst is responsible for monitoring, managing, and optimizing inventory levels for a company while working remotely. They analyze inventory data, forecast demand, and coordinate with suppliers to ensure stock availability while minimizing excess inventory. Their role often involves using inventory management software, generating reports, and collaborating with different teams to improve supply chain efficiency. This position requires str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work independently.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a remote inventory analyst?

As a Remote Inventory Analyst, your typical day involves monitoring inventory levels, analyzing trends and usage data, and preparing regular reports to optimize stock and minimize shortages or overages. You will use inventory management software to reconcile discrepancies, coordinate with suppliers and internal teams, and assist in forecasting demand. Communication often occurs via email, video calls, and collaborative project tools, requiring comfort with remote workflows. Your role is crucial in maintaining efficient operations and supporting strategic decision-making, even while working from a home-based setting.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ote inventory analyst?

To thrive as a Remote Inventory Analyst, you need strong analytical abilities, attention to detail, and a degree in business, supply chain, or a related field. Familiarity with inventory management systems such as SAP, Oracle, or NetSuite, along with proficiency in Excel and data visualization tools, is highly valuable. Excellent organizational skills, proactive communication, and self-motivation are important soft skills for excelling in a remote environment. These competencies ensure accurate inventory tracking, seamless collaboration with cross-functional teams, and effective problem-solving while working independently.

PURPOSE: 
The Business Analyst will have the responsibility to ensure that the business's need for changes to processes, policies and/or information systems are identified, understood, defined, documented and acted upon by eliciting, analyzing, documenting, validating, specifying and verifying the needs of business or user.  The incumbent assists in the gathering and synthesizing of business requirements for low complexity software, systems, processes and/or services and translates them into specifications ensuring the business objectives are met.  As the functional expert, the incumbent serves as the conduit between the business area and the technical or software development team through which requirements flow.  
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

  • Interpret business needs and issues by gathering, eliciting, analyzing, documenting and validating the Business area's user and technical (functional/non-functional) requirements. Under the direction of a Lead or Senior Business Analyst, participates in the creation of requirements documentation. Collaborates in the creation of project plans to define, organize and schedule requirements management and development activities. Participates in requirements analysis and verification sessions. Participates in the tracking and management of open issues and assists in planning for resolution. Participates in development sessions and design reviews in order to ensure design meets user requirements.
  • Responsible for the overall success of user acceptance testing, including documentation, verification and release. Implements practices and procedures for end user test plans. Identifies and documents gaps in requirement adherence or system deficiencies/defects and coordinates appropriate action through issue resolution. Providing guidance and training to application end users. 
  • Identifies, documents and troubleshoots problems in systems, software and processes. Collaborate with appropriate stakeholders to monitor, report and resolve issues.  Participates in the development of solutions and workarounds that solve low complexity technical, system and/or business issues.  
  • Reviews, analyzes and creates detailed documentation of business systems and user needs. Responsible for the written documentation of requirements in a clear and well organized manner. Develops and/or collaborates in key project and requirement deliverables for projects of low complexity.
  • Monitors and reports project status to identify and mitigate risks and to ensure quality and timely deliverables. Coordinates assigned projects from concept through implementation. Prioritize and manage new work requests. 

QUALIFICATIONS:
Education Level: Bachelor's Degree in Business, Information Technology, Computer Science or related field OR in lieu of a Bachelor's degree, an additional 4 years of relevant work experience is required in addition to the required work experience.
Experience: 3 years experience in functional, operational, business, data, systems or testing analysis.
